Understanding Licensing and Regulation

The cornerstone of a trustworthy online casino is its licensing and regulation. A valid license signifies that the casino has met a set of stringent standards established by a reputable regulatory body. These standards typically cover aspects such as fairness of games, security of financial transactions, and responsible gambling practices. Different jurisdictions have different regulatory auth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, and the Curacao eGaming. Each authority has its own specific requirements and oversight procedures. Players should always verify that a casino holds a valid license from a recognized authority before depositing any funds or engaging in gameplay. A lack of proper licensing is a significant red flag and should be avoided.

The Importance of Independent Audits

Beyond licensing, reputable online casinos often undergo independent audits by third-party organizations. These audits are designed to verify the fairness and randomness of the casino's games. Organizations like e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) perform rigorous testing of random number generators (RNGs) to ensure that game outcomes are truly unpredictable and not manipulated in favor of the house. The results of these audits are typically published on the casino's website, providing players with transparency and assurance. Looking for casinos that proudly display their audit results is a good indicator of their commitment to fair play. This process gives peace of mind to players knowing that the games they are participating in are legitimate.

Security Measures and Data Protection

Protecting your personal and financial information is vital when gambling online. Reliable online casinos employ cutting-edge security measures to safeguard player data from unauthorized access and cyber threats. These measures typically include S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ption, which encrypts data transmitted between your computer and the casino's servers, making it unreadable to eavesdroppers. Additionally, reputable casinos utilize fir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and other advanced security technologies to protect their systems from attacks. Players should also look for casinos that are P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ard) compliant, which ensures that they adhere to strict standards for handling credit card information. Checking for these security features is a crucial step in ensuring a safe online gambling experience.

Two-Factor Authentication and Responsible Account Management

Enhancing account security goes beyond the casino’s security infrastructure; players also have a responsibility to protect their own accounts. Enabling two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security by requiring a second verification code, typically sent to your mobile device, in addition to your password. This makes it significantly more difficult for hackers to gain access to your account, even if they manage to obtain your password. Furthermore, practicing responsible account management, such as using strong, unique passwords and avoiding the reuse of passwords across multiple sites, is essential. Regularly reviewing your account activity and promptly reporting any suspicious activity to the casino’s support team can also help prevent fraud.

  • Strong Passwords: Use a comb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ols.
  • Unique Passwords: Avoid reusing passwords across multiple websites.
  • Two-Factor Authentication: Enable 2FA whenever possible for added security.
  • Regular Account Reviews: Monitor your account activity for any unauthorized transactions.

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Withdrawal Limits

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, dictate the amount of money you must wager before you can withdraw any bonus funds or winnings generated from those funds. For example, if a casino offers a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ement, you must w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w it. Understanding these requirements is crucial to avoid disappointment and ensure a smooth withdrawal process. Additionally, casinos often impose withdrawal limits, which restrict the maximum amount of money you can withdraw in a single transaction or over a specific period. Being aware of these limits is important, especially for high-rollers who may need to make larger withdrawals.

  1. Review Wagering Requirements: Understand the playthrough requirements before accepting a bonus.
  2. Check Withdrawal Limits: Be aware of any daily, weekly, or monthly withdrawal limits.
  3. Verify Processing Times: Inquire about the typical processing time for withdrawals.
  4. Confirm Verification Procedures: Understand the documentation needed for identity verification.

Beyond providing assistance with technical issues or account inquiries, responsible gaming is a critical aspect of a trustworthy online casino. Reputable casinos are committed to promoting responsible gambling practices and providing resources to help players stay in control of their gambling habits. These resources may include self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, loss limits, and time limits. Self-exclusion programs allow players to voluntarily ban themselves from accessing the casino for a specified period. Deposit and loss limits allow players to set limits on the amount of money they can deposit or lose within a given timeframe. Time limits restrict the amount of time players can spend gambling on the platform. Offering these tools demonstrates a casino’s commitment to player well-being and responsible gambling.
